Our loving mother and grandmother, DeAun Irene Nukaya, 94, of Idaho Falls, passed away September 27, 2023, at Rigby Lake Assisted Living. She was under the care of Solace Hospice.
DeAun was born August 23, 1929, in Sedgwick, Kansas, to Glen and Irene Stewart. She grew up and attended schools in Roberts and Idaho Falls and graduated from Idaho Falls High School in 1947.
On January 13, 1948, she married George Hisao Nukaya in Walla Walla, Washington. DeAun and George made their home in Roberts, Idaho, on the family farm where they raised their five children. After retiring, they moved to Idaho Falls.
She was a member JACL, Roberts Flower and Garden, and the Roberts Ladies Lions Club. She enjoyed cooking and was a great cook! She enjoyed sewing dance costumes for Pam and her own clothing. She loved fishing, gardening, outings, and ski trips with family and friends. She also enjoyed watching Rick with his tractor pulls and Larry with his monster truck.
DeAun is survived by her son, Jay (Afton) Nukaya of Roberts, ID; daughter, Pamela Summers of Idaho Falls, ID; son, Richard Nukaya of Idaho Falls, ID; 7 grandchildren and 18 great grandchildren.
She was preceded in death by her parents; husband, George Hisao Nukaya; son, DelRay Nukaya; son, Larry Allen Nukaya; granddaughter, Debra Mulberry; and brother, Dick Stewart.
Graveside services will be held 11:00 a.m. Wednesday, October 4, 2023, at Fielding Memorial Park Cemetery.
